EASTWEST is offering 50% off the retail prices of two titles: EASTWEST/QUANTUM LEAP SYMPHONIC ORCHESTRA and PIANOS on all purchases made through March 31, 2012.
The company says that, recorded by 11-time Grammy nominated classical recording engineer Prof. Keith O. Johnson, and produced by Doug Rogers and Nick Phoenix, the EASTWEST/QUANTUM LEAP SYMPHONIC ORCHESTRA is the most awarded orchestral collection ever, and the only orchestral collection to be recorded in a "state of the art" concert hall where orchestras mainly perform. Here's more of what EASTWEST has to say in their own words...
EASTWEST/QUANTUM LEAP PIANOS is the most detailed collection of the world's finest grand pianos ever recorded and includes a Bechstein D-280, Steinway D, Bösendorfer 290, and Yamaha C7, each recorded with 3 mixable mic positions. "These are real acoustic piano sounds. I'm absolutely amazed. EastWest/Quantum Leap has gone the extra mile to provide stunning quality acoustic piano character - the whole collection is superb!" said 12-time Grammy winning pianist and composer Herbie Hancock. "The new meaning of heavyweight. Players agreed that EastWest/Quantum Leap has by far the most detailed and biggest-sounding pianos of the bunch." Said KEYBOARD Magazine. The PLAY interface includes impulses from the same hall the producers used to record Symphonic Orchestra and Symphonic Choirs so the pianos can blend with those collections.
